Abstract
This paper studies the square roots of total Boolean matrices. The basic matrices are introduced and it is proved that all the square roots of the total Boolean matrix can be constructed from the basic ones. Next the basic matrices of order 2, 3, 4, 5 are enumerated and they are connected with directed graphs. Finally some issues are discussed concerning applications of self-organization and routing in wireless sensor networks.
